Tour de Thar is set to delight adventure cyclists in its inaugural edition as riders will get the opportunity to navigate the expansive desert in northwestern India. 

Rajasthan is set to host an international-level endurance cycling event that blends sports, culture, and the unique spirit of the desert.

The event invites cyclists from across the nation and the globe to experience the challenge of the Thar Desert and showcase the power of human determination.

When will the Tour de Thar Take Place? 

The cycling event will be held on November 23.

Where will the Tour de Thar Take Place? 

The race will be flagged off from Norangdesar to Deshnok, spread across the smooth, expansive stretches of the Amritsar-Jamnagar Expressway. The race will pass through the sands of endurance presented by the Thar desert as a stage for showcasing courage and determination.

Tour de Thar: Features

The inaugural edition of the tournament features three demanding categories—300 km Relay, 200 km, and 100 km—designed to test every cyclist’s stamina, strength, and mental fortitude. 

Over 2500 participants, including professional riders from across the globe, alongside passionate enthusiasts, are expected to take on the desert winds, rising dunes, and rolling terrain, creating a thrilling spectacle for competitors and spectators alike.

Along the route, spectators can look forward to local music performances, traditional dances, and handicraft exhibitions, creating an immersive desert festival that celebrates the state’s identity alongside the thrill of competition.

Tour de Thar 2025: Complete Schedule

Event Date(s) Time Notes
Athlete Check-In 21st & 22nd November 2025 10:00 AM – 5:00 PM Mandatory for all participants to collect race kit
Race Expo 21st & 22nd November 2025 10:00 AM – 5:00 PM Open to all
Race Briefing 22nd November 2025 2:00 PM – 3:00 PM Mandatory attendance
Race Day 23rd November 2025 5:00 AM – 5:00 PM Be prepared and arrive early
Awards Ceremony 23rd November 2025 7:30 PM – 10:00 PM Celebrate the winners and achievements
